Why Sewage Backups Hit Kuna Hard
The pattern in Kuna is consistent. spring snowmelt infiltrating aging sewer lines through cracks and root intrusion drives most of the emergency restoration calls we get.
Kuna's climate, with heavy spring snowmelt and clay soil, increases the risk of sewage backup. The combination of thawing ground and older sewer lines can lead to overflow, especially in areas with poor drainage.
